Output 1aefcc3b4631b79084430e7918952f40101c220abd0dffc589ebf31facd614ac:0

value
10434903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d65f34cbd920e4fa4b06e88cee5cbe5accca69b OP_EQUAL
address
32urqg6KSj56DX43U5GVDdhiop5Pyt8MMK
transaction
1aefcc3b4631b79084430e7918952f40101c220abd0dffc589ebf31facd614ac
confirmations
169904
spent
true